Upgrade StarTeam
If you have used previous releases of StarTeam Server, you must upgrade each of your server configurations after installing the new release. The upgrade process varies depending upon:
- Which database you are using.
- Which previous release of StarTeam Server you are using.
To determine if a patch is required before you upgrade, contact Technical Support at: https://www.microfocus.com/support .
Overview of the upgrade process
You can upgrade to the latest version of StarTeam Server only from StarTeam Server 2014 or higher. If you are on an earlier release, contact support for a customized upgrade plan. The customized upgrade plan takes into consideration the previous versions of the Operating System and database in use, and may require multiple steps.
For StarTeam Server 2014 or higher, follow the steps below:
- Back up your StarTeam repositories and other server files.
- If necessary, upgrade or migrate your database to a version supported by StarTeam Server <latest version>. For details on migrating a database, see Database requirements for upgrading.
- Install the latest version of the StarTeam Server .
After the upgrade, the server file location is changed. The old starteam-server-configs.xml file is copied from the old StarTeam Server release’s installation folder to the new release’s installation folder. This ensures that all configurations running on the previous StarTeam Server release can access the new StarTeam Server release.
Preparing for an upgrade
Before upgrading, do the following:
Perform test upgrades | We strongly recommend running test upgrades against copies of current production databases. |
Create an upgrade schedule |
Plan your StarTeam Server upgrade when it will inconvenience the smallest number of users. A StarTeam Server configuration cannot be running during some of the steps you take before and during the upgrade. You may want to plan the StarTeam Server upgrade at the end of the workday or perhaps on a weekend. If you have a large repository or a slow system, the upgrade process could be time consuming. Depending on the size of your database, you might need to schedule a couple of down-times for the upgrade. For example, you might schedule one weekend for upgrading the StarTeam Server and another for upgrading the database. Make backups before and after each of these steps to prevent loss of data. Advise your team ahead of time that you plan to make this transition during a specified period of time, and advise them when they will need to have the latest version of a StarTeam client installed. Unless specifically stated, StarTeam clients for a given release work with that StarTeam Server release, one release back, and one release forward. When an older client works with a newer StarTeam Server, the client cannot access new features. For example, the older client cannot display any new menu commands. |
Backup the server configuration | Make certain you have current, verified backups of the files and folders for the StarTeam Server configuration (database files, archive files, and so on) prior to starting important steps in the upgrade process. |
Requirements for an upgrade
This section describes the steps that you follow to upgrade to the latest version of StarTeam Server, elaborating on the table provided in Overview of the upgrade process and providing references to related sections for more detailed information. Before upgrading to the latest version of StarTeam Server, you need to:
- Review the pre-installation issues for a new installation to determine whether any of them apply to you.
- You can upgrade to the latest version of StarTeam Server only from StarTeam Server 2009 R2+. If you are on an earlier release, take the steps necessary to upgrade from that release to StarTeam Server 2009 R2. See the appropriate installation guides for details. Be sure to also install the latest patches. You can find information about the latest patches at https://www.microfocus.com/support.
- Back up your StarTeam repositories and other server files. See the documentation for the release of StarTeam Server that you currently have installed for information about what to back up.
You cannot install StarTeam Server while server configurations are running. Therefore, you must perform one of the following procedures.
To shut down a StarTeam Server configuration that is not running as a Microsoft Windows service: - Open the Server Administration tool, by selecting . The Server Administration tool opens.
- Select the server configuration, and choose . After you confirm that you want to shut down the server, the Status icon changes from Running to Stopping to Ready.
If your StarTeam Server configurations run as Microsoft Windows services, you must stop those services and change the StarTeam execution mode: - Click . The Services window opens.
- Locate the Server configuration and click Stop.
- After the service stops, close the Services dialog box and the Control Panel.
- Stop the server configuration from being run as a service. For example, in Server 2009 R2, start the Server Administration tool by selecting . The Server Administration tool opens.
- Select the server configuration, and choose . This menu command changes from checked to unchecked, indicating that the server configuration is no longer running as a service. The server configuration’s icon also changes.
- Install the latest version of StarTeam Server on the same computer as the version of Server that you are upgrading from.
-
If necessary, upgrade or migrate your database to a version supported by Server latest version. For more information, see
Database requirements for upgrading.
Note: Performing the StarTeam Server installation and the database upgrade in different sessions, such as different weekends, allows you to isolate any problems to one step or the other. If your database version is not one that is supported by the latest version of StarTeam Server, perform the database migration prior to installing the latest version of StarTeam Server. If performing an upgrade of both the StarTeam Server and the database, upgrade the database, install StarTeam Server, then upgrade or migrate your database to another database version.
- Upgrade your server configurations. For more information, see Upgrading server configurations.
Upgrading server configurations
After you install StarTeam Server, every existing server configuration must be upgraded.
To upgrade the server configurations:
- Open the Server Administration tool by clicking Start > Programs > Micro Focus > StarTeam Server <version> > StarTeam Server
- Select the server configuration to be upgraded. Even if the status for the server configuration indicates Ready, the server configuration will not start successfully until you run the upgrade procedure.
-
Click the
Upgrade Database toolbar button.
A series of dialog boxes may open and close. At the completion of the process, a message indicates a successful upgrade operation.
If an error occurs, a message displays the error information. The upgrade process creates a log file named
DBUpgrade.locale.log in the server configuration's repository folder. For example, if the locale is the United States, the name of the file is
DBUpgrade.en-US.log.
Note: The upgrade process requires one database connection to run. If the upgrade process is unable to acquire a connection, it will fail.
Check the database connection information on the StarTeam Server computer. From the computer on which the server is installed:
- Open the Server Administration tool.
- Select the server configuration.
- Click .
- From the Properties dialog box, select the Database Connections tab.
Click Verify.
Ensure that the database is running.
Post-Installation tasks for an upgrade
If you are upgrading from a previous release of StarTeam Server, be aware of the following:
- You must upgrade all existing StarTeam Server configurations to use the latest release of StarTeam Server. For more information about upgrading server configurations, see Upgrading server configurations.
- If you use ActiveMQ MPX, be sure to install the latest Message Broker and MPX Cache Agents. For more information, see MPX installation on Windows .
- For more information about installation and upgrade instructions for StarTeam Workflow Extensions, see StarTeam Workflow Extensions installation.